The journey from Hallandale Beach to Seattle spans the entire breadth of the United States. Flying from FLL to Seattle-Tacoma International Airport is the most practical method. Driving involves a massive trek north and west, typically utilizing I-95 to I-90. You will traverse the Great Plains and the Rocky Mountains. This route offers a dramatic transition from tropical Florida to the temperate rainforests of the Pacific Northwest.
Total Distance: Driving distance 5,300 km; straight-line air distance 4,350 km.
